Enter, a subset of derek.
subset (noun): a set each of whose elements is an element of an inclusive set.
Source: Merriam-Webster Online Dictionary.
So, a subset of derek is merely part of a whole. I am pursuing a Bachelor’s degree in mathematics, as many of you know. Subsets are merely parts of a set. Subsets are also crucial to proving set equality. If two sets are subsets of each other (meaning that there is no item that can be found in A that cannot be found in B and vice versa, given that A and B are sets, of course) then they are equal.
